 Teach Me Communism Episode 187: Engels’ Origin of the Family, Private Property, and the State Part 2
 Feb 8, 2024 
 Discussion on community dynamics from an anarchist perspective, exploring communistic society and equality in community care. Analyzing the transition in societal structures and evolution of governance, including Athenian societal evolution and Rome's transition to a republic. Delving into historical marriage customs, female property ownership, and the origins of kingship and transition to states. Exploring the significance of universal suffrage for the working class and ending with a whimsical conversation on aliens and capitalism.
